MODIDO is a universal meta-model for the IoT domain, consisting of concepts that can be used to build a solution model for an IoT application. This solution can be edited using text notation and can be drafted through code generation. This article discusses the principles observed and methods used to build the MODIDO meta-model. Two principles are applied: the principle of universality and the principle of specificity. The two methods used are model architecture and layered development.
